Responsibilities
The Night Auditor is responsible for attending to the needs of guests, balancing the revenue and expense transactions that occurred during the day, and performing all the functions of the front desk staff during the audit shift. The Night Auditor will possess good communications and guest service skills and have the ability to take appropriate action to meet and exceed guest expectations.

Qualifications

  • High school graduate or equivalent.
  • Minimum one year customer service experience; previous hotel experience preferred.
  • Ability to satisfactorily communicate with guests, management, and co-workers to their understanding.
  • Computer experience preferred.
  • Bilingual English/Spanish a plus.
  • Knowledge of local activities and attractions appropriate for clientele.
